QUOTE(xsi @ Aug 14 2020, 11:52 AM)
MKV mostly.

before this on wifi...recently changed using cat5e...+ latest maxis fiber standard router (standing type) to both NAS and Zidoo, still got problem.
I dont think my NAS supprt gigabit. its the not-so-young WD sharecenter

do we need gigabit for 4k playback?

Will try to check codec, or diff apps etc. Not sure how to change the native player for Kodi though.

Would like to use Kodi or native Zidoo software if possible due to poster thingy features.
*
4K movie, most likely yes you need a Gb port. I was having that issue before but mainly because the previous media box doesn't have a Gb port, so even 1080p mkv will lag terribly. Now i bought another box with Gb port, so NAS (Gb port) to Maxis router to TV box (Gb port), kodi 4k movie is ok already.

QUOTE(writesimply @ Nov 2 2021, 03:07 PM)
If you play a HDR content using an Android box that can handle HDR but a monitor/TV that cannot, you get washed out video. To fix this, Kodi has enable tone-mapping feature with 4 settings. However, it seems that only Kodi on Windows and NVidia Shield can enable this feature due to the GPU involved.
*
yeah, Kodi on Windows will play the HDR file correctly. My Sony TV has HDR10 compatibility and I'm using TVBox with Android 9,(S905X3) which supposed to support Support H.265, 8K, 4K, HDR+. Do you see any area that is causing the issue ?
